Unbeatable Hardness for Tough Machining Materials
Carbide drill bits stand head and shoulders above traditional steel drill bits when it comes to hardness, and this is the most prominent advantage that makes them a staple in modern CNC machining. Industry material science experts confirm that carbide has a hardness rating of up to HRA90, far surpassing the HRC60 of high-speed steel, which means carbide drill bits can easily cut through alloy steel, stainless steel, and even heat-treated metals that ordinary drill bits can’t touch. Our carbide drill bits are designed with optimized helix angles and cutting edge geometries, which reduce cutting resistance and allow for ultra-high rotational speeds without overheating or vibration. International machining industry guidelines state that carbide drill bits can operate at 3 to 5 times the cutting speed of high-speed steel drill bits, and our R&D team has taken this a step further by adding inner cooling channels to our deep hole carbide drill bits, which deliver cutting fluid directly to the cutting zone to keep the drill bit cool during high-speed work. Unlike steel drill bits that flex and wear unevenly during use, leading to hole deviation and rough edges, our carbide drill bits have an extremely rigid shank that eliminates vibration and flex during drilling. We also use advanced grinding technology to finish the cutting edges of our carbide drill bits, ensuring every edge is perfectly calibrated for clean, precise cuts.
